Activate and customize per-article-use purchase

These administrative settings let you provide access to the full text of individual journal articles included in Electronic Collections Online on FirstSearch when your library does not maintain a subscription to the journal through Electronic Collections Online.

Journal settings. You turn on or off access to full text from individual journals included in your Electronic Collections Online on FirstSearch subscription. In some cases you can also enable per-article-use purchase, allowing full text from individual journals not covered by your FirstSearch subscription to be available for viewing.

Purchase settings. These settings let you control the cost of per-article-use purchase in Electronic Collections Online:

  • Create a per-article-use purchase budget. Set the maximum amount you are willing to pay for individual articles using per-article-use purchase in the Electronic Collections Online database on FirstSearch. Disable per-article-use purchase for journals that exceed this amount.
  • Select journals by price. Enable per-article-use purchase for all journals that have a current year or backfile price less than or equal to the maximum article price on the Purchase Settings screen. Disable per-article-use purchase for all other journals.
  • Set a maximum article price. Turns off links to the full text of articles that have a price greater than the maximum article price that you set.
  • Display the article price. Display each article’s price in the FirstSearch link to the article’s full text.
  • Request e-mail notices. You can choose to receive an e-mail when price changes for journals or articles go into effect or per-article-use purchase is enabled for a journal. You may also opt for an e-mail notice when the amount spent in the current month reaches your budget amount.
